from paramecio2.libraries.db.webmodel import PhangoField
from paramecio2.libraries.db import coreforms
from paramecio2.libraries.i18n import I18n
class IntegerField(PhangoField):
"""Class that figure an integer sql type field.
Args:
name (str): The name of new field
size (int): The size of the new field in database. By default 11.
required (bool): Boolean for define if
"""
def __init__(self, name, size=11, required=False):
super(IntegerField, self).__init__(name, size, required)
self.default_value=0
def check(self, value):
"""Method for check if value is integer
Args:
value (int): The value to check
"""
self.error=False
self.txt_error=''
try:
value=str(int(value))
if value=="0" and self.required==True:
self.txt_error="The value is zero"
self.error=True
except:
value="0"
self.txt_error="The value is zero"
self.error=True
return value
def get_type_sql(self):
"""Method for return the sql code for this type
"""
return 'INT('+str(self.size)+') NOT NULL DEFAULT "0"'
class BigIntegerField(IntegerField):
"""Class that figure an big integer sql type field.
Only change the sql type with respect to IntegerField
"""
def get_type_sql(self):
"""Method for return the sql code for this type
"""
return 'BIGINT('+str(self.size)+') NOT NULL DEFAULT "0"'
class FloatField(PhangoField):
"""Class that figure an float sql type field.
Args:
name (str): The name of new field
size (int): The size of the new field in database. By default 11.
required (bool): Boolean for define if
"""
def __init__(self, name, size=11, required=False):
super(FloatField, self).__init__(name, size, required)
self.error_default="The value is zero"
self.default_value=0
def check(self, value):
"""Method for check if value is integer
Args:
value (float): The value to check
"""
self.error=False
self.txt_error=''
try:
value=str(value)
if value.find(',')!=-1:
value=value.replace(',', '.')
value=str(float(value))
if value==0 and self.required==True:
self.txt_error=self.error_default
self.error=True
except:
value="0"
self.txt_error=self.error_default
self.error=True
return value
def get_type_sql(self):
return 'FLOAT NOT NULL DEFAULT "0"'
class DecimalField(FloatField):
def get_type_sql(self):
return 'DECIMAL(20, 2) NOT NULL DEFAULT "0"'
class DoubleField(FloatField):
def get_type_sql(self):
return 'DOUBLE NOT NULL DEFAULT "0"'
